Should you put homemaker on a resume?

If your stay-at-home-mom resume lists homemaker activities that are related to your job target, it makes sense to draw attention to your parenting activities and accomplishments. For most people, though, it’s best to avoid including parenting as an actual job on the resume.

Should you add stay at home mom on resume?

For some stay-at-home moms, being at home with the kids meant a break in full-time, salaried work, but did not mean a break in paid work. If you’ve worked on a contract, temp, or freelance basis, that’s absolutely relevant information, and it should be included on your resume.

What is the job description of a homemaker?

Homemakers, also known as housekeepers and household managers, organize and oversee all of the activities needed for the day-to-day running of households and estates, as well as manage other domestic concerns.

How many jobs to put on a resume?

Most experts recommend including 10-15 years of work history on your resume. For the majority of professionals, this includes between three and five different jobs.

How to put current job on resume?

When listing your current job on your resume, use the present tense, and use the past tense for previous jobs you’re including, recommends job search website Indeed.com. Present your current position in a way that demonstrates you’re qualified for the role you’re seeking.

What does homemaker services mean?

Homemaker services means non-medical services provided by social services, in the absence of other resources, to assist an eligible Indian in maintaining self-sufficiency, and preventing placement into foster care or residential care. Examples of services included in homemaker services are: cleaning an individual’s home, preparing meals for an individual, and maintaining or performing basic household functions.
